SBAC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2022 in Review

673 of the 6,340 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in SBA Communications (SBAC) for Q1 2022, worth a combined $35.1B — down 12% from $40B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 78 funds closed out of SBAC and 63 opened new positions — a net loss of 15 holders — while 253 trimmed existing stakes and 244 added.

The largest buyer was T. Rowe Price Associates, adding an estimated $238M. The largest seller was AKRE Capital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$602M sold.
